El museo posee una variada … The Natural History Museum in London is a museum that exhibits a vast range of specimens from various segments of natural history. It is one of three major museums on Exhibition Road in South Kensington, the others being the Science Museum and the Victoria and Albert Museum. The Natural History Museum's main frontage, however, is on Cromwell Road. The museum is home to life and earth science specimens comprising some 80 million items wit…

WebNatural History Museum, London At the Natural History Museum in London , geology enthusiasts can explore the Earth Hall, where they’ll find a diverse collection of rocks, minerals, and fossils. Highlights include the 1,400-pound iron meteorite and a giant sequoia tree slice, showcasing the natural beauty and unique features of our planet’s geology.
